Με επιτυχία ολοκληρώθηκε η φετινή Build, στο San Francisco καθώς ο πρωταρχικός στόχος της ήταν να ενημερωθούν οι πελάτες της Microsoft για το πώς μπορούν να αυξήσουν το Developer Velocity τους, μιας και ο σκοπός είναι να ενδυναμωθεί η γνώση του κάθε προγραμματιστή ώστε να δημιουργεί εφαρμογές και λύσεις με τα ολοκληρωμένα εργαλεία της Microsoft.
Σε αυτό το πλαίσιο, η Microsoft έκανε κάποιες σημαντικές ανακοινώσεις με βάση τους τρεις βασικούς πυλώνες του Developer Velocity framework:
– Build productively: H τελευταία ενημέρωση του Visual Studio 2019 είναι διαθέσιμη και η Microsoft κυκλοφόρησε το Visual Studio 2022. Για το Microsoft Teams η εταιρεία ανακοίνωσε νέες δυνατότητες που μπορούν να χρησιμοποιήσουν οι προγραμματιστές για να δημιουργήσουν καινοτόμα σενάρια και να επεκτείνουν τις συσκέψεις του Teams μιας και η βελτιωμένη Microsoft Teams toolkits απλοποιεί την ανάπτυξη εφαρμογών εντός του Teams. Επιπλέον, η Microsoft ανακοίνωσε επίσης νέες εφαρμογές εντός των εργαλείων των Windows για developers ώστε να αυξηθεί η παραγωγικότητα των πελατών της.
– Scale your innovation: Οι τελευταίες καινοτομίες Azure Applied AI της Microsoft επιτρέπουν στους προγραμματιστές να εκσυγχρονίσουν υπάρχουσες εφαρμογές καθώς και να δημιουργούν εφαρμογές που είναι εγγενείς cloud εφαρμογές. H Microsoft διευκολύνει τον εκσυγχρονισμό εταιρικών εφαρμογών Java στο Azure με το Microsoft Build of OpenJDK. Επιπλέον ανακοινώθηκε η δυνατότητα προεπισκόπησης για υπηρεσίες εφαρμογών Azure που μπορούν να τρέχουν σε Kubernetes και Azure Arc.
Αυτό επιτρέπει στους πελάτες να εκτελούν τις αγαπημένες τους υπηρεσίες εφαρμογών Azure οπουδήποτε, στο edge και σε άλλες εφαρμογές cloud όπως το AWS ή το Google. Κάθε cluster σύμπλεγμα Kubernetes που συνδέεται μέσω του Azure Arc είναι πλέον ένας υποστηριζόμενος στόχος ανάπτυξης για τις υπηρεσίες εφαρμογών του Azure. Οι νέες επεκτάσεις ξεκλειδώνουν ταυτόχρονα περαιτέρω τη δύναμη του Visual Studio και της πλατφόρμας Power. Επιπλέον, έρχεται μια διαισθητική εμπειρία κατασκευαστή υποβοηθούμενη από AI στο Power Fx που υποστηρίζεται από το GPT-3 AI, το μεγαλύτερο μοντέλο φυσικής γλώσσας στον κόσμο.
Συνεργατικές εφαρμογές για υβριδική εργασία
Μια νέα ανακοίνωση αφορά το πώς οι προγραμματιστές μπορούν να δημιουργήσουν την επόμενη γενιά συνεργατικών εφαρμογών για υβριδική εργασία.
Στην ουσία, η Microsoft καλύπτει την άνοδο μιας νέας κατηγορίας εφαρμογών που ονομάζεται «συνεργατικές εφαρμογές» (collaborative apps) που δημιουργήθηκε για τον υβριδικό χώρο εργασίας – με επίκεντρο τη συνεργασία έναντι της ατομικής παραγωγικότητας και παρέχει την ευελιξία να εργάζεται οποιασδήποτε από οπουδήποτε, με οποιονδήποτε και οποτεδήποτε.
Η Microsoft δίνει τη δυνατότητα πια στους πελάτες της να δημιουργούν συνεργατικές εφαρμογές μέσω του Microsoft Teams
Στην ουσία αναδεικνύονται νέες δυνατότητες για API συσκέψεις, API πολυμέσα και extensibility mode που ενισχύουν την ανάπτυξη καλύτερων εμπειριών συσκέψεων. Όμως, η συνεργασία δεν περιορίζεται μόνο στο Teams μιας και μοιράζεται ο τρόπος με τον οποίο οι προγραμματιστές μπορούν να δημιουργήσουν στοιχεία Fluid στα μηνύματα του Teams και επεκτάσεις μηνυμάτων εντός του Teams και στην Web εφαρμογή του Outlook. Επίσης, η Microsoft διευκολύνει τους διαχειριστές και τους χρήστες στην αγορά εφαρμογών απευθείας από το Teams καθώς έχει βελτιώσει το Teams Toolkit για Visual Studio / Visual Studio Code και Developer Portal για να κάνει ακόμη πιο εύκολη τη δημιουργία, τη διαμόρφωση και τη διαχείριση εφαρμογών. Τέλος, από σήμερα, κυκλοφορεί η ιδιωτική προεπισκόπηση των στοιχείων Fluid στη συνομιλία του Teams και επεκτείνεται η κυκλοφορία τους επόμενους μήνες σε περισσότερους πελάτες.
Παροχή εμπειριών με επίκεντρο τα δεδομένα, την ευφυΐα και την ασφάλεια
Το Microsoft Graph είναι μια πλούσια πηγή δεδομένων που επικεντρώνεται στα άτομα μιας εταιρείας εμπλουτίζοντας εμπειρίες σε εφαρμογές και συσκευές, όπως Universal Actions for Adaptive Cards. Το Microsoft Graph αποτελεί ένα σημείο σύνδεσης που επιτρέπει σε λύσεις τρίτων να συμμετέχουν σε εμπειρίες μέσω του Graph Connectors που επιτρέπουν την αναζήτηση, το eDiscovery και άλλα. Ο πλούτος και η κλίμακα των συνόλων δεδομένων στο Microsoft Graph επιτρέπει να αναπτυχθούν λύσεις που υποστηρίζονται από AI / ML για να μετατραπεί η συνεργασία, όπως η Viva Connections μέσω του SharePoint Framework (SPFx) και του Microsoft Graph Data Connect.
Σύγχρονες εφαρμογές Windows που λειτουργούν απρόσκοπτα σε οποιοδήποτε σημείο
Με τη μετάβαση στην απομακρυσμένη και τώρα υβριδική εργασία – ο υπολογιστής είναι πλέον απαραίτητος. Οι προγραμματιστές μπορούν να χρησιμοποιήσουν ένα ενοποιημένο σύνολο API και εργαλείων που χρησιμοποιούνται με συνεπή τρόπο για τη δημιουργία σύγχρονων εφαρμογών με την πιο πρόσφατη επανάληψη της προεπισκόπησης Project Reunion 0.8, για να δημιουργούν απρόσκοπτα σημεία στα τερματικά πελατών και cloud με βασικές ενημερώσεις, όπως η υποστήριξη χαμηλού επιπέδου για την έκδοση Windows 10 1809, .NET 5 support, WinUI 3 and WebView 2 support.
Οι προγραμματιστές μπορούν επίσης να λάβουν υποστήριξη εφαρμογών GUI στο Υποσύστημα Windows για Linux (WSL), έτσι ώστε όλα τα εργαλεία και οι ροές εργασίας να είναι εύκολα διαθέσιμα. Το Windows Terminal μπορεί πλέον να οριστεί ως ο προεπιλεγμένος εξομοιωτής τερματικού – επιτρέποντας σε όλες τις εφαρμογές γραμμής εντολών να ξεκινήσουν μέσω αυτού.
Οι άλλες ανακοινώσεις της εταιρείας
– Η πλατφόρμα Power Platform είναι, σύμφωνα με τη Microsoft, ο καλύτερος τρόπος να δημιουργούν συγχωνευμένες ομάδες εφαρμογές, αυτοματισμούς και bot για να υποστηρίξουν εταιρείες που θέλουν να προσφέρουν λύσεις γρηγορότερα και πιο αποτελεσματικά. Η Command line interface (CLI) για το Power Platform επιτρέπει τη συνεργασία μεταξύ πολιτών και επαγγελματιών προγραμματιστών με τη διαχείριση αρχείων και συσκευασίας πηγαίου κώδικα. Οι ενσωματώσεις Native Power Platform Visual Studio και Visual Studio Code δίνουν τη δυνατότητα στους προγραμματιστές να χρησιμοποιούν τα εργαλεία της επιλογής τους. Παράλληλα, ο επιταχυντής διαχείρισης κύκλου ζωής εφαρμογών (ALM) για το Power Platform επιτρέπει στους προγραμματιστές με απρόσκοπτη δυνατότητα επέκτασης σε Power Platform, GitHub και Azure. Αυτές οι νέες δυνατότητες θα βοηθήσουν τους προγραμματιστές να συμμετέχουν εύκολα σε συγχωνευμένες ομάδες και να φέρουν αξία στις εταιρείες τους σε χρόνο ρεκόρ.
– Μια άλλη καινοτομία που ανακοίνωσε η Microsoft στα πλαίσια της Build καλύπτει τον τρόπο με τον οποίο οι πελάτες μπορούν να δημιουργήσουν εφαρμογές cloud με δικό τους τρόπο και να τις ενεργοποιήσουν οπουδήποτε. Στην ουσία θα μπορούν να μετακινούνται γρήγορα με τις υπηρεσίες της ετοιμοπαράδοτης εφαρμογής από Azure, που είναι διαθέσιμες σήμερα οπουδήποτε στο Kubernetes με το Azure Arc.
– Τέλος, έμφαση δίνεται στον τρόπο με τον οποίο οι πελάτες μπορούν να επιταχύνουν την καινοτομία στην εταιρεία τους, παρέχοντας νέες έξυπνες εμπειρίες εφαρμογών cloud με δεδομένα Azure και AI.